软件质量,不但依赖于架构及项目管理,而且与代码质量紧密相关。这一点,无论是敏捷开发流派还是传统开发流派,都不得不承认。
本书提出一种观念:代码质量与其整洁度成正比。干净的代码,既在质量上较为可靠,也为后期维护、升级奠定了良好基础。作为编程领域的佼佼者,本书作者给出了一系列行之有效的整洁代码操作实践。这些实践在本书中体现为一条条规则(或称“启示”),并辅以来自现实项目的正、反两面的范例。只要遵循这些规则,就能编写出干净的代码,从而有效提升代码质量。
本书阅读对象为一切有志于改善代码质量的程序员及技术经理。书中介绍的规则均来自作者多年的实践经验,涵盖从命名到重构的多个编程方面,虽为一“家”之言,然诚有可资借鉴的价值。
##这本书重在对细节的关注。书的编排极其合理,从最小的点开始一点点往大处讲。感觉对刚开始工作的小朋友们,代码看得、写得还不够多,读设计模式之类的书可能还没什么体会。但这本代码细节的书,却是能立竿见影,直接用到工作中去的。
评分##就内容而言 偏贵
评分##写代码犹如写文章
评分##这本书重在对细节的关注。书的编排极其合理,从最小的点开始一点点往大处讲。感觉对刚开始工作的小朋友们,代码看得、写得还不够多,读设计模式之类的书可能还没什么体会。但这本代码细节的书,却是能立竿见影,直接用到工作中去的。
评分##每个码农都应该读。
评分##参数尽量少,函数抽象层级
评分##虎头蛇尾之典范,半本经典书,只要看前10章就好,后面就水了,翻译的功底也很差,但是还是要推荐。
评分##或许Java应该这样码,C++这样搞就完蛋了。换句话说,作者确实有所感悟,但过于死板,好的代码应该灵活变通、因地制宜。
评分##1注释保持简洁,避免冗余 2函数参数尽量少 避免布尔参数 3变量命名应具体 准确,能让代码具有可读性 4用多态替代if else或者switch语句 5用命名变量代替魔术数 6长布尔逻辑改为准确的一个函数判断 7一个函数只做一件事 8才用描述性名称命名,而不是abcdefg 9避免命名歧义,避免前缀……
本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度,google,bing,sogou 等
© 2026 book.tinynews.org All Rights Reserved. 静思书屋 版权所有